# Break-Glass: Catalog Cache Invalidation

Scope: the Pinrow product catalog at Veldstone Retail. If stale prices persist after a purge and the Hollowmere invalidation queue is wedged, use break-glass to flush the edge tier directly. Contractors: get verbal sign-off from the catalog lead first. Steps: open the Hollowmere admin shell, select emergency-flush, confirm the tenant, and run it once — repeated flushes thrash the origin. Access is logged and expires after 20 minutes. Unseal the admin shell with the passphrase below.

recovery phrase for kahop-tajog: istix-casvan

Subject: Second-source supplier hunt — where we are

Team,

Quick update for the board pack: we've shortlisted three candidates to back up Mirren Componentry on the actuator line. Two passed the initial quality audit; the third is wobbly on lead times but strong on price. Pilot orders go out next month, and we'll have comparative data by quarter-end. No commitments signed yet. Context on why this matters is in the note below.

confidential, kagep-kahof: Druokax Systems plans to lower the Ulaath list price by 53 percent in March.

MEMO — Veltrane Systems, Receiving, Dorsey Point site

Six Quillax M4 demo units are being returned from the Harwick trade floor. All were powered down and factory-reset by the field team; do not re-image before intake inspection. Log serial plates against the loan sheet and flag any missing styli. Cartons are marked DEMO RETURN in orange. Expected arrival Thursday morning via courier. Storage bay 3 is reserved. The confidential hand-over instruction for the courier follows below.

courier memo of kagug-yajof: the belys wenok courier leaves the praix ledger at gate 8902 under passcode 669584